色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

MySQL外鍵默認(rèn)名稱是什么?

簡介:MySQL是一種流行的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),它支持外鍵約束來確保數(shù)據(jù)的完整性。當(dāng)創(chuàng)建外鍵時(shí),MySQL會(huì)默認(rèn)生成一個(gè)外鍵名稱。本文將介紹MySQL外鍵默認(rèn)名稱是什么。

回答:MySQL外鍵默認(rèn)名稱是由MySQL系統(tǒng)自動(dòng)分配的一個(gè)名稱,它通常是在創(chuàng)建外鍵時(shí)生成的,也可以在創(chuàng)建表時(shí)手動(dòng)指定。MySQL默認(rèn)外鍵名稱的命名規(guī)則為“fk_”加上外鍵所在表名加上外鍵關(guān)聯(lián)表名,例如“fk_table1_table2”。

當(dāng)創(chuàng)建外鍵時(shí),如果沒有指定外鍵名稱,MySQL會(huì)根據(jù)默認(rèn)規(guī)則自動(dòng)生成一個(gè)名稱。這個(gè)名稱是唯一的,并且可以通過查詢系統(tǒng)表來查看。如果手動(dòng)指定外鍵名稱,則必須確保名稱是唯一的,否則會(huì)拋出錯(cuò)誤。

下面是一個(gè)示例,展示了如何在MySQL中創(chuàng)建一個(gè)外鍵,并查看默認(rèn)分配的外鍵名稱:

CREATE TABLE table1 (

id INT PRIMARY KEY,ame VARCHAR(50)

CREATE TABLE table2 (

id INT PRIMARY KEY,

table1_id INT,

FOREIGN KEY (table1_id) REFERENCES table1(id)

-- 查看默認(rèn)分配的外鍵名稱straintameformationastraintsstraint_type = 'FOREIGN KEY'ame = 'table2';

formationa表來查看默認(rèn)分配的外鍵名稱。

總結(jié):MySQL外鍵默認(rèn)名稱是由MySQL系統(tǒng)自動(dòng)分配的一個(gè)名稱,它遵循命名規(guī)則“fk_”加上外鍵所在表名加上外鍵關(guān)聯(lián)表名。如果沒有指定外鍵名稱,則MySQL會(huì)根據(jù)默認(rèn)規(guī)則自動(dòng)生成一個(gè)名稱??梢酝ㄟ^查詢系統(tǒng)表來查看默認(rèn)分配的外鍵名稱。